The opportunity

       Join Hitachi Energy. as a Management Trainee and embark on a structured program designed to cultivate future leaders. This entry-level professional role offers a comprehensive introduction to our diverse operations, preparing you for a successful career within our global organization.

How you’ll make an impact

       As a Management Trainee, you will gain hands-on experience and contribute to various business functions. Your responsibilities will include, but are not limited to:

  • Participating in rotations across different departments (e.g., Sales, Marketing, Operations, Finance, Human Resources) to gain a holistic understanding of Hitachi's business.

  • Assisting senior management with project planning, execution, and reporting, contributing to strategic initiatives.

  • Conducting market research, data analysis, and competitive landscape assessments to support business development efforts.

  • Collaborating with cross-functional teams on problem-solving and process improvement initiatives.

  • Developing and delivering presentations to internal stakeholders on project updates and findings.

  • Learning and applying Hitachi's values, business principles, and operational best practices.

  • Actively participating in training sessions, workshops, and mentorship programs to enhance professional skills.

  • Contributing to the achievement of departmental and company-wide goals.

Your Background

  •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Industrial Engineering, Energy Engineering, or a related technical field.

  • Strong academic record with a demonstrable aptitude for learning and problem-solving.

  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to articulate complex ideas clearly and concisely.

  • Demonstrated leadership potential and a proactive, results-oriented mindset.

  • Ability to work effectively both independently and as part of a team in a fast-paced environment.

  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int).

  • Strong analytical and critical thinking abilities.

  • A keen interest in Hitachi's industries and technologies.

  • Flexibility and adaptability to new challenges and environments.

  • Fluency in Arabic and English; additional languages are an advantage.
